Introduction to Press Roll Covering Material
The process of papermaking involves various stages where water is removed from the pulp.
One crucial step in this process is pressing, where a press roll is used to squeeze out water.
The material used to cover these rolls can significantly affect the efficiency of dewatering.
Choosing the right material ensures that maximum water is removed, improving the quality and production speed of the final product.
Understanding Dewatering in Paper Production
Dewatering is a critical factor in paper production as it impacts the strength and quality of the paper.
During the pressing stage, the pulp passes through a series of press rolls designed to remove as much water as possible.
This stage not only ensures that the paper dries faster but also saves energy costs involved in the drying process.
Using the appropriate roll covering material can dramatically increase the effectiveness of water extraction.
Types of Press Roll Covering Materials
There are several materials used for press roll coverings, each with its unique properties affecting dewatering efficiency.
Rubber Covering
Rubber is a commonly used material due to its flexibility and affordability.
It provides good grip and is resistant to various chemicals that may be present in the pulp.
However, it may not be as durable as other materials, requiring frequent replacements.
Polyurethane Covering
Polyurethane offers better resilience and durability compared to rubber.
It withstands higher pressures and has a longer service life.
Its smooth surface also allows for better water drainage, enhancing dewatering efficiency.
Composite Materials
Composite materials, made by combining different fibers and resins, offer excellent dewatering performance.
These materials can be customized to provide specific properties needed in various types of papermaking processes.
They are durable and maintain their structure under high pressure, making them ideal for high-speed papermaking.
Factors Affecting the Selection of Roll Covering Material
Several factors should be considered when selecting the appropriate roll covering material to ensure optimal dewatering efficiency.
Type of Paper Being Produced
Different types of paper require different levels of dewatering.
For instance, newsprint and cardboard may require different press roll coverings due to their unique dewatering needs.
Choosing a material that matches the specific paper type can greatly enhance efficiency.
Production Speed
Higher production speeds demand materials that can withstand increased pressure and stress.
Materials like polyurethane and composites are suitable for high-speed operations as they offer greater durability and efficiency.
Operating Environment
The chemical composition of the pulp and the operating environment play crucial roles in selecting the roll cover material.
Some materials may degrade quickly due to exposure to chemicals, reducing their effectiveness.
It is vital to choose materials that are resistant to specific chemicals used in the papermaking process.
The Impact of Material Choice on Dewatering Efficiency
The choice of press roll covering material directly influences the dewatering efficiency and, consequently, the overall profitability of the papermaking process.
Using an appropriate material can:
– Increase water extraction, reducing drying costs.
– Improve paper quality by ensuring consistent moisture levels in the final product.
– Extend the lifespan of the equipment by reducing wear and tear.
Maximizing Efficiency with Proper Maintenance
Regular maintenance and timely replacement of the press roll coverings are necessary to sustain efficiency.
Even the best materials will degrade over time, and worn coverings can lead to decreased performance and even damage to the machinery.
